If you get the Bookport here's a few thing to be aware of:

When you get ready to buy another compact flash memory card, be sure that it
is a type 1 flash card.  There are lots of "flash memory" products that will
not work with the BP.

The Bookport will not work with Windows 98 or 98SE.  You'll need to use
Windows Me, 2000, XP, or later

You'll want to put most of your text and audio files into their own folders
rather than into the root directory of the BP.

It also looks like the unit works best with no more than a certain maximum
number of files in each folder.  I started out putting as many as 150 or
more files into a folder but quickly learned that made moving through the
list of names very sluggish.  I've kept it down to 60 or less and it works
great.  someone else on the list may have a better max files number than the
60 that I've reported here.
